The Association on American Indian Affairs (AAIA) is one of the oldest organizations dedicated to promoting the welfare of American Indians and Alaska Natives through advocacy, cultural preservation, and educational support. It provides scholarships and financial assistance to Native students pursuing higher education, helping them achieve degrees that benefit their communities while maintaining connections to their Native Nations.
